Endangered animals are species that are at a very high risk of disappearing in the wild in the near future, either worldwide or in a particular country. The International Union for Conservation of Nature (IUCN) Red List of Threatened Species serves as a critical indicator of the health of the world’s biodiversity, and its findings paint a sobering picture of a planet losing its precious wildlife at an accelerated pace. This crisis is not merely an ecological concern; it is a profound moral and practical challenge for humanity.
The sheer scale of the problem is staggering. Scientists estimate that the current rate of extinction is 10s to 100s of times higher than the natural background rate. This means we are losing species faster than at almost any other time in Earth’s history, largely due to human activities. This rapid decline in biodiversity weakens ecosystems, making them less resilient to environmental changes and diminishing the vital services they provide to humanity, such as clean air, fresh water, and pollination. The roster of species facing imminent peril is extensive and deeply concerning. Among those critically endangered or with precarious populations are the amur leopard, with fewer than 100 individuals left in the wild; the Sunda Island Tiger (often referred to as the Sumatran tiger), pushed to the edge by habitat loss and poaching; and the vaquita, the world’s smallest and most endangered marine mammal, a victim of illegal fishing practices. Other iconic species include the Javan rhino and black rhino, relentlessly hunted for their horns; the Bornean orangutan and Cross River gorilla, whose forest homes are disappearing; the African forest elephant, targeted for its ivory; and the elusive saola, often called the “Asian unicorn.” The list continues with the flightless kakapo parrot, the majestic Philippine eagle, the resilient red wolf, various species of pangolins (the world’s most trafficked mammals), the adorable sea otter, the distinctive hawksbill turtle, the colossal blue whale, the elusive snow leopard, the rare Ethiopian wolf, the desert-dwelling addax, and the soaring California condor, which is slowly recovering thanks to intensive conservation efforts. These 20 examples represent just a fraction of the life forms at risk, each a unique strand in the web of life.
Foremost among the drivers of this crisis is habitat loss and degradation. As the human population expands and our demand for resources grows, natural landscapes are increasingly converted for agriculture, urbanization, infrastructure development, and resource extraction. Forests are felled, wetlands are drained, grasslands are plowed, and coral reefs are destroyed, leaving countless species without the food, shelter, and breeding grounds they need to survive. This relentless encroachment into wild spaces is the single greatest threat to the majority of endangered animals, pushing them into ever-smaller and more fragmented pockets of their former ranges.
Compounding the issue of outright habitat loss is habitat fragmentation. Even when natural areas are not completely destroyed, they are often broken up into smaller, isolated patches. These “islands” of habitat can be too small to support viable populations of many species, particularly those with large territorial requirements or specialized needs. Fragmentation also restricts gene flow between populations, leading to inbreeding and reduced genetic diversity, which in turn makes species more vulnerable to disease and environmental stressors. Roads, fences, and other human-made barriers further exacerbate this isolation, hindering migration and dispersal.
The pervasive and accelerating impacts of climate change represent another formidable threat to animal populations worldwide. Rising global temperatures are altering weather patterns, leading to more frequent and intense heatwaves, droughts, floods, and wildfires. These changes directly impact species by modifying their habitats, disrupting food availability, and altering breeding cycles. Polar animals, for instance, are losing their sea ice habitats, while coral reefs are bleaching due to warmer, more acidic oceans. Many species are unable to adapt or migrate quickly enough to these rapidly changing conditions, pushing them towards endangerment.
Pollution, in its myriad forms, acts as a silent but deadly killer of wildlife. Chemical pollutants from agriculture, industry, and urban runoff contaminate water bodies and soil, poisoning animals directly or accumulating in the food chain. Plastic pollution poses a significant threat, particularly to marine life, through ingestion and entanglement. Light and noise pollution can also disrupt animal behaviors, affecting foraging, communication, and reproduction. The insidious nature of many pollutants means their impacts can be widespread and long-lasting, contributing significantly to the decline of sensitive species.
Overexploitation, driven by human demand, remains a critical factor in the endangerment of many animals. This includes unsustainable hunting for food or sport, overfishing that depletes marine stocks and results in bycatch of non-target species like sea turtles, and relentless poaching. The illegal wildlife trade, a multi-billion dollar global industry, fuels this crisis, incentivizing the trafficking of endangered animals and their parts for exotic pets, luxury goods, and traditional medicines. Species like rhinos, tigers, elephants, and pangolins have been decimated by this illicit trade, despite international bans and conservation efforts. This black market not only pushes species towards extinction but also involves immense cruelty and risks the spread of zoonotic diseases.
The introduction of invasive alien species is another significant contributor to the endangerment of native wildlife. When non-native species are introduced into new environments, either intentionally or accidentally, they can outcompete native animals for resources, prey upon them directly, or introduce diseases to which native species have no immunity. Islands are particularly vulnerable, where unique, often naive, native fauna can be quickly decimated by introduced predators like rats, cats, or snakes. Invasive species disrupt ecological balances and can be incredibly difficult and costly to control or eradicate.
The consequences of species extinction are far-reaching and profound. Each species plays a role in its ecosystem, and its loss can trigger a cascade of negative effects, a concept known as “extinction cascades.” Predators control prey populations, herbivores shape plant communities, and pollinators are essential for plant reproduction. The loss of a keystone species, one that has a disproportionately large effect on its environment relative to its abundance, can lead to dramatic changes in ecosystem structure and function. Ultimately, this diminishes the ecosystem’s ability to provide essential services that benefit human well-being.
Despite the grim outlook, hope remains. Conservation efforts around the world are working tirelessly to protect and recover endangered species. These initiatives include the establishment and management of protected areas, habitat restoration projects, captive breeding and reintroduction programs, anti-poaching patrols, and community-based conservation programs that empower local people to become stewards of their wildlife. International agreements like CITES (Convention on International Trade in Endangered Species of Wild Fauna and Flora) aim to regulate and restrict trade in threatened species. Scientific research plays a crucial role in understanding the threats and informing effective conservation strategies.
